Output 3a89a0421d599516880c556de49ae89db7532208f133670f18b0bf0760ec9356:5

value
20796816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2028dde37dbf2b5ece7986f7e7e3c79c5eeefca OP_EQUAL
address
3PkeWS7Dayp9KAsbLd58wMDSsUXNjU6eti
transaction
3a89a0421d599516880c556de49ae89db7532208f133670f18b0bf0760ec9356
spent
true